Overview of the AMD Ryzen 7 5700 and AMD Ryzen 7 9800X3D

The AMD Ryzen 7 5700 is priced at $167.00, making it significantly more affordable than the AMD Ryzen 7 9800X3D, which costs $468.99. This price difference of about 180% reflects not only the performance capabilities but also the intended user base for each processor. While both processors feature 8 cores and 16 threads, their architectures and targeted applications vary greatly, appealing to different segments of the market.

Performance Capabilities

The AMD Ryzen 7 9800X3D is touted as the world's fastest gaming processor, built on AMD's innovative ‘Zen 5’ technology. It offers an impressive maximum clock speed of up to 5.2 GHz and a substantial 96MB L3 cache for enhanced performance. In contrast, the Ryzen 7 5700 features a maximum boost of 4.6 GHz, leveraging the advanced AMD "Zen 3" architecture. While both processors are capable of handling demanding applications, the Ryzen 7 9800X3D is particularly optimized for high-end gaming and content creation, likely giving it an edge in tasks that require intense processing power.

Architecture and Technology

In terms of architecture, the Ryzen 7 5700 is built on the proven “Zen 3” architecture, which has been well-received for its efficiency and performance. Conversely, the Ryzen 7 9800X3D utilizes the new “Zen 5” architecture, which boasts about 16% IPC uplift over its predecessor and improved power efficiency. This advancement positions the Ryzen 7 9800X3D as a forward-thinking option for users looking to future-proof their systems, while the Ryzen 7 5700 remains a solid choice for those seeking reliable performance at a lower cost.

Cooling Solutions

The Ryzen 7 5700 comes with the premium AMD Wraith Spire Cooler included, which ensures that users have a reliable cooling solution right out of the box. This is particularly beneficial for those who may not wish to invest additional money in aftermarket cooling. In contrast, the Ryzen 7 9800X3D does not include a cooler, which may require buyers to factor in the cost of an efficient cooling solution, especially given its higher performance capabilities and associated thermal output.

Upgrade Path and Compatibility

Both processors utilize different socket platforms, which could impact potential upgrades. The Ryzen 7 5700 is compatible with the established Socket AM4 platform, providing users with a straightforward upgrade path within that ecosystem. The Ryzen 7 9800X3D, however, is designed for the newer Socket AM5 infrastructure, which can offer future compatibility with upcoming technologies but may require a more substantial investment in a new motherboard and possibly RAM, as it supports the latest DDR5 memory.

Which should you buy?

Choosing between the AMD Ryzen 7 5700 and the AMD Ryzen 7 9800X3D ultimately depends on your specific needs and budget. If you are a gamer or content creator seeking top-tier performance and are willing to invest significantly, the Ryzen 7 9800X3D is the clear choice. However, if you are looking for a robust processor that performs well in everyday tasks without breaking the bank, the Ryzen 7 5700 is an excellent option at about 64% less than the 9800X3D. Each processor has its strengths, making them suitable for different users.
